1st home practice in the new home.




There's something to be said about people who practice yoga daily in their homes. (for example: Jillji). These people are warriors. They are devoted. They are amazing to me. It's hard to physically get yourself to the mat. It really is. This morning I thought about going to the shala for an early morning practice since I couldn't make it to evening mysore, but I slept in. So I watched Glee on the sofa and ate an apple with honey and peanut butter. I digested said apple while cleaning the floors and fiddling around with some stuff to get ready to practice. I put down my mat around 10am and practiced. The window was open. It wasn't hot or cold. Just perfect. I worked up a decent sweat. I had the dogs barricaded in the kitchen. I did full primary plus a (half-assed) 2nd series up to Kapo. I didn't do drop backs or Urdhva Danurasana. I was just too exhausted. I did a few closing poses and then just laid on the floor for a bit for savasana. I got my ladie's holiday yesterday, so I'm feeling a little sluggish.

I'm financially not stable enough to pay for yoga. This is a re-occurring theme in my life. I typically clean floors and toilets in exchange for free yoga. (or mostly free). I'm ok with practicing at home. I like it. But how long will I be able to do this for? I know how hard it is not to have the community energy around me. For now, this is what my practice is.

6 things I'm loving about practice right now....

I borrowed this idea from Christina's Blog, Prescribing Yoga.

1. I love the vinyasas between the asana's in 2nd series. It's seriously beautiful and fun. I love when you pick yourself up after Ustrasana and Laghu Vajrasana. It's just wild.

2. I love that I still can't do a headstand for more than 5 breaths at a time. It will come soon. I love that I keep trying and trying and trying.

3. I love that this practice is physical and mental. There are so many mental challenges... For example, I've been kind of freaking out right before drop backs recently. Totally mental. I love that my mind is challenged as much as my body is.

4. I love the quietness in the room. Just breath and some whispers. Sometimes there's a loud thud, I like that too.

5. I love the repetition. I like that everyday things feel different even though you're practicing the same thing.

6. I love that yoga has become part of my lifestyle. I told my friend's that I needed a hobby... They said, Isn't yoga a hobby? I said, No, It's my lifestyle. It truly has shaped my life.
